OpEd News.com broke the story of Dr. Ben Marble, a young emergency room physician who plays in alternative rock bands and does art on the side and told off Dick Cheney before the media on Sept. 8, being detained and hand-cuffed by Cheney’s goons in front of his destroyed home after the media cameras left.

Our story has helped the eBay auction of Marble’s video of his Cheney confrontation climb above $1,900, as of early Sept. 10. But we’d like to do more to help Marble, who lost his Gulfport, Miss., home and most of his possessions in Hurricane Katrina.

So we’re raising funds at OpEd News to go towards helping replace some of the items he lost.
